DEFINITION:
The number of square kilometers of land area that is artificially supplied with water.

| # | COUNTRY | AMOUNT | DATE | GRAPH | HISTORY |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| India | 663,340 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 2 | China | 641,410 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 3 | United States | 230,000 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 4 | Pakistan | 199,900 sq km | 2008 | ||
| South Asia average (profile) | 189,226 sq km | 2008 | |||
| 5 | Philippines | 152,500 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 6 | European Union | 131,250 sq km | 2003 | ||
| South and Central Asia average (profile) | 89,726.33 sq km | 2008 | |||
| Emerging markets average (profile) | 88,906.39 sq km | 2008 | |||
| 7 | Iran | 87,000 sq km | 2009 | ||
| Non-religious countries average (profile) | 74,620.91 sq km | 2008 | |||
| 8 | Indonesia | 67,220 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 9 | Mexico | 64,600 sq km | 2009 | ||
| 10 | Thailand | 64,150 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 11 | Brazil | 54,000 sq km | 2011 | ||
| 12 | Turkey | 53,400 sq km | 2012 | ||
| Group of 7 countries (G7) average (profile) | 51,668.33 sq km | 2008 | |||
| 13 | Bangladesh | 50,500 sq km | 2008 | ||
| Religious countries average (profile) | 48,388.83 sq km | 2008 | |||
| 14 | Vietnam | 46,000 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 15 | Russia | 43,460 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 16 | Uzbekistan | 42,230 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 17 | Italy | 39,500 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 18 | Egypt | 35,300 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 19 | Iraq | 35,250 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 20 | Spain | 34,700 sq km | 2011 | ||
| 21 | Afghanistan | 31,990 sq km | 2008 | ||
| 22 | Romania | 31,570 sq km | 2008 | ||
